Output ebc3e3675754a107ce44b16ddcdf0752e30d57d33b49bb13c90de2cfdb2f9edd:0

value
745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fef37b07fca119de1ad3c2bf51f42454aaf085 OP_EQUAL
address
3MHowudLc3NxWcuqhLP98zeNKX1jkWMiW3
transaction
ebc3e3675754a107ce44b16ddcdf0752e30d57d33b49bb13c90de2cfdb2f9edd
spent
true